The Rise of Real Money Online Casinos: Industry Evolution and Market Drivers

Over the past decade, the global online gambling market has experienced exponential growth, fueled by advancements in internet accessibility, mobile device proliferation, and regulatory reforms. According to industry reports, the global online gambling revenue was valued at over $50 billion in 2022, with a projected comp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 11% until 2028 (Source: Statista, 2023). This trend underscores an industry that continuously innovates to meet the evolving demands of a diverse and increasingly sophisticated player base.

Key factors propelling this expansion include:

  • Technological innovation: The integration of live dealer games, virtual reality, and augmented reality enhances realism and engagement.
  • Regulatory diversification: Progressive licensing laws in jurisdictions such as the UK, Malta, and Ontario offer players safer environments and operators legitimacy.
  • Payment solutions: The adoption of cryptocurrencies and seamless fiat options ensures smoother transactions.

Regulatory Frameworks and Their Impact on Player Trust

Regulations such as the UK Gambling Commission’s licensing requirements or Malta Gaming Authority standards impose strict compliance measures. These frameworks protect consumers and foster trust—an indispensable asset in a competitive market. For players, understanding the credentials behind a platform’s licensing can be the difference between entertainment and exposure to fraudulent operators.

For operators, aligning with recognized regulatory bodies necessitates transparency in operations, fair gaming practices, and sufficient safeguards against addiction and underage gambling. Operational success in such environments demands compliance with detailed policies, which often include secure payment systems and rigorous auditing procedures. The Role of Advanced Data Analytics and User Experience

In recent years, data analytics has become the backbone of personalized player engagement. From tailored marketing campaigns to adaptive game design, insights gleaned from vast data pools enable operators to fine-tune user experiences, increase retention, and optimize monetization strategies. Additionally, emerging technologies like blockchain not only enhance transparency but also facilitate real-time auditing, fostering trust among users.
